#Fusion_Development The exciting time for #SPARC is coming!

CFS Chief Science Officer and Co-founder Brandon Sorbom offers a ground-level view of how we'll assemble the SPARC fusion machine inside Tokamak Hall. SPARC's cryostat base now is in place, and toroidal field (TF) magnets and a vacuum vessel are coming next. Catch the second of…

#Fusion_Development China's next reactor name has changed from #CFETR (China Fusion Engineering Test Reactor) to #CFEDR (China Fusion Engineering Demo Reactor), according to the following article, Fusion power has increased to a 3GW-class now iopscience.iop.org/article/10.108…
